Job Description

What you'll do

As a Sr. Graphic Designer, you’ll have the opportunity to shape how brands are seen and experienced across channels. You’ll design with impact, collaborate with smart teammates, and push creative boundaries while staying grounded in what drives response. In this role, you will:

  • Design compelling, on-brand direct mail campaigns that grab attention and motivate response
  • Develop visual assets for additional channels such as email, digital advertising, and social media, to ensure a cohesive and integrated brand experience
  • Collaborate with marketing strategists and subject matter experts to conceptualize creative campaigns that align with business objectives and target audience insights
  • Translate marketing strategies into clear, effective, and visually appealing layouts that break through the clutter, maximize response, & drive conversion rates for our clients
  • Present creative concepts with recommendations to internal and external clients, including creative rationales for design choices and its expected impact on performance.
  • Prepare and deliver print-ready and digital files, ensuring accuracy, quality, and consistency across all channels and formats
  • Stay current with design trends, direct mail innovations, and emerging technologies to continually elevate creative
  • Test and iterate designs based on performance analytics and feedback, optimizing for audience engagement and conversion
  • Maintain organized creative files, templates, and documentation of design processes and workflows
  • Review final productions for errors and ensure the final material reflects the specifications received

Who You Are

  • You’re more than a designer—you’re a creative problem solver who blends artistry with strategy. You thrive on variety, excel at collaboration, and take pride in work that not only looks great but also drives results. You bring:
  • Bachelor’s degree in Graphic Design, Visual Communications, or a related field (or equivalent professional experience)
  • 10+ years of experience in graphic design, with a strong portfolio showcasing direct mail, print production skills, and multichannel campaign work (DM, EM, Landing Pages, Display Ads)
  • Experience in data-driven design and personalized direct mail tactics and testing
  • Expert in Adobe Creative Suite (InDesign, Photoshop, Illustrator); experience with email and digital ad platforms a plus (Figma, Designmodo, After Effects, or Basic HTML); must also be proficient in Microsoft Office (PPT, Word, Excel)
  • Strong understanding of principles of layout, typography, color theory, and print production processes
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ills; 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ams, and present to Senior Leadership and clients
  • Demonstrated creativity, originality, and a strategic approach to solving marketing challenges through design
  • Self-motivated, curious, detail-oriented, brand steward, and able to manage multiple projects and deadlines in a fast-paced environment
  • Knowledge of HTML/CSS or email design best practices
  • Knowledge of UX design best practices
  • Strong conceptual thinker with the ability to bring fresh ideas to traditional and digital formats, and experience with competitor research
  • Ability to adapt to feedback and provide art direction to vendors or freelance design partners
  • Demonstrated experience with light copywriting (headlines, taglines, call-to-action phrases, etc.)
  • Other duties and responsibilities as assigned

What We Offer: 

  • Base salary $115,000-$125,000, plus benefits, opportunity for bonus, and a remote work environment
  • Comprehensive benefits program including Medical, Dental, Vision
  • 401k with matching
  • Flexible PTO
  • Short and Long Term Disability
  • Unique opportunity to become an Employee Owner through our ESOP program!
